Ok! here's my two cents of opinion.

First consider where you plan to do PPL, in India it may consume more time, in US or canada think you have to spend around 1.5 lakh for travel after PPL and continue your CPL.

Say, if you are dependent on bank loan, it may be good idea to do PPL first clear dgca exams. While you appear for exams you only have a debt of 5+lakh after PPL and not 20+lakh after CPL as it may have added pressure on you.

If you are unable to clear your conversion exams in six months your license gets lapsed to renew and appear for another attempt you have to log additional 15hrs PIC, 5hrs night and 5hrs intrument time.

If your fear is only exams and if you are a loan dependent guy/gal do PPL clear DGCA exams then continue to CPL Beware! you may waste valuable time!

If you belive you can clear in one attempt do directly enroll for CPL.
